✔️ Premium Hex Shank 3 1/2 Long 30.6mm Diameter Steel
This single premium steel Forstner drill bit specializes in cutting exact 30.6 millimeter openings for half dollar coin displays. It features a sharp outer spur that peels wood fibers cleanly without splintering dense hardwoods. Woodworkers and hobbyists rely on this handy tool to mount coins securely in frames, cabinets, and display panels.
✅ Cutting Diameter measures 1-13/64 inch (30.6 mm) for accurate coin sizing✅ Overall Length runs 3-1/2 inch (89 mm) to handle thick wooden boards
✅ Exclusive No-Slip 3/8 inch (10 mm) hex shank locks firmly in standard drills
✅ Item 9274H features hardened steel body with self-centering flat nose point
